Question from Deputy Liam Quaide - PQ 75027-25
Deputy Quaide asked about the dispensing arrangements under the free HRT scheme which limits hormone replacement therapy to one month’s supply at a time.

To ask the Minister for Health if she will review the current dispensing arrangements under the free HRT scheme which limit hormone replacement therapy to one month’s supply at a time; the rationale for this restriction; the impact it has had on continuity of care during ongoing supply disruptions, including for estradot patches; if consideration has been given to allowing multi-month dispensing where clinically appropriate and where supply permits; and if she will make a statement on the matter.
